Transaction 72fe29a1d02e24a9f6d66123991380925ecae611ade4579ffb17b7a81d41534f

1 Input
2 Outputs
  • 72fe29a1d02e24a9f6d66123991380925ecae611ade4579ffb17b7a81d41534f:0
  • value  505227798
    address  1kB7D4hm6DKCGawj2kmTT13faqW2jjwU2
  • 72fe29a1d02e24a9f6d66123991380925ecae611ade4579ffb17b7a81d41534f:1
  • value  250000000
    address  13oyx6QAjvvaMZ5YWYDvt3XchPgNmLe6Ds